¿Existe alguna forma, tal vez con un archivo por lotes, de determinar si el PDF tiene un número impar de páginas y, de ser así, agregar espacios en blanco?

¿Existe alguna forma, tal vez con un archivo por lotes, de determinar si el PDF tiene un número impar de páginas y, de ser así, agregar espacios en blanco?

Todos los días recibo una gran cantidad de archivos PDF (más de 100) que necesito combinar e imprimir a doble cara. Lamentablemente, no todos tienen un número par de páginas, por lo que la impresión no se realiza a doble cara correctamente.

¿Hay alguna forma en un archivo por lotes de ver el número de páginas de un PDF y agregar una página en blanco si el PDF tiene un número impar de páginas?

Respuesta1

SejdaLa consola puede ayudar (descargo de responsabilidad: soy uno de los desarrolladores):

./bin/sejda-console merge --addBlanks --directory my_files --output my_merged_files.pdf

La opción --addBlanks agregará una página en blanco si el número de páginas del pdf es impar.

Este comando de muestra fusiona todos los archivos pdf en la carpeta my_files.

Descargue la última versión desde aquí:https://github.com/torakiki/sejda/releases

¡Espero eso ayude!

información relacionada